Salary data and insights based on 277 job postings
Human Resources professionals in entertainment earn a median salary of $60,000 at entry-level, rising to $97,500 at mid-level and $147,500 for senior roles. Across 277 job listings, the field is concentrated in Los Angeles, New York, and Burbank, reflecting the industry's geographic hub structure. Core competencies in demand include Employee Relations, Performance Management, Change Management, Microsoft Excel, and Project Management.
